The functions of the Customs are as follows:
1. Supervise and manage import and export goods, passengers' luggage and postal articles, and inbound and outbound means of transport, some of which are called customs clearance management, others are called ensuring that goods and articles enter and leave the country legally;
2. Collection of customs duties and other taxes and fees. In many countries, in addition to collecting tariffs, customs also collect domestic taxes and fees in import and export, such as value-added tax, consumption tax, oil tax and so on. In some countries, customs also levy anti-dumping duties, countervailing duties and fines on imported goods.
3. Investigate smuggling. Customs departments of various countries investigate and deal with acts of evading supervision, commercial fraud and tariff evasion, especially smuggling goods and articles, especially drugs, which are prohibited and restricted from entering or leaving the country. Customs in various countries have intensified their investigations. The customs of other parts or individual countries have special functions, such as compiling foreign commodity trade statistics, bonded management, coastal patrol alert, managing navigation and protecting copyright and patent rights.
People's Republic of China (PRC) Customs Law Article 3 The General Administration of Customs shall be established in the State Council to administer the customs in a unified way.
The State shall set up customs at ports open to the outside world and places where customs supervision business is concentrated. The subordinate relationship of the customs is not restricted by administrative divisions.
The Customs shall exercise its functions and powers independently according to law and be responsible to the General Administration of Customs.
Article 4 The State shall set up a public security organ in the General Administration of Customs to investigate smuggling crimes, staffed with full-time anti-smuggling police, and be responsible for the investigation, detention, arrest and pre-trial of smuggling crimes within its jurisdiction.
Customs investigation of smuggling crimes The public security organ shall perform the duties of investigation, detention, execution of arrest and pre-trial in accordance with the provisions of the Criminal Procedure Law of People's Republic of China (PRC).
When investigating smuggling crimes, the customs public security organs may set up branches in accordance with relevant state regulations. When handling cases of smuggling crimes under their jurisdiction, all branches shall transfer them to the people's procuratorate with jurisdiction for prosecution according to law.
Local public security organs at all levels shall cooperate with the Customs in investigating smuggling crimes and perform their duties according to law.
